Foundation Stabilizing in Charles County, MD
Foundation stabilizing services involve techniques to reinforce and support a building’s foundation when signs of shifting or settling appear. These services are often requested for residential properties experiencing uneven floors, cracked walls, or gaps around windows and doors. Projects can include underpinning, pier installation, or soil stabilization, all aimed at restoring stability to the structure and preventing further damage. Common Foundation Stabilizing Jobs
Foundation stabilization involves reinforcing and supporting foundations to prevent settling or shifting.
Pier and beam repair helps restore stability in homes with raised or uneven floors.
Slab leveling corrects uneven concrete slabs to improve safety and prevent further damage.
Foundation underpinning strengthens weak or compromised foundations to ensure long-term stability.
Wall stabilization addresses bowing or cracking walls caused by shifting soil or moisture issues.
Soil injection services improve soil conditions around foundations to reduce settling and shifting.
Foundation Stabilizing Questions
What is foundation stabilizing? Foundation stabilizing involves techniques to strengthen and support a building’s foundation, helping to prevent or repair settling and shifting issues.
When should foundation stabilization be considered? It may be needed if there are signs like cracks in walls, uneven floors, or doors that don’t close properly.
What types of projects typically require foundation stabilization? Projects include addressing foundation settlement, correcting uneven floors, and repairing cracks caused by soil movement.
How does foundation stabilization benefit property owners? It helps maintain structural integrity, prevents further damage, and can improve the safety and value of a property.
